Museums won't put their art collection in the garbage because they have taken care long enough. With public art works however, especially in the Netherlands, it seems a normal practice. Lots of art in public space is just being destroyed. In this research project young artists video-registered what factors and actors determine the fate of cultural heritage.They implicitly outline the contours of a new vulnerable generation in a hardened politicized artistic climate. This group of artists managed to play a crucial role of significance.

JAVA is the first film within the project History-Memory-Commemoration, a long-term collaboration between artist Iswanto Hartono and researcher Mirwan Andan, both members of the Indonesian collective Ruangrupa, and Dutch artist Hans van Houwelingen. The project aims to produce eight films, each recorded on specific locations in Indonesia and the Netherlands, that relate to their shared colonial history: Java, Aceh, Nias, Netherlands, Sulawesi, Kalimantan, Moluccas and Papua.

History, Memory, Commemoration is a research project by researcher Mirwan Andan (Makassar), artists Iswanto Hartono (Jakarta/Kassel) and artist Hans van Houwelingen (Amsterdam/Berlin). The project will result in eight films, each recorded on specific locations in Indonesia and the Netherlands that relate to a shared colonial history. The first film JAVA is recorded in Jakarta and was released in February 2024, the second film ACEH in September 2024. This film was recorded in Aceh and pictures how history is remembered and commemorated within the specific Aceh culture. It shows the influences of tradition, islam, politics, education, historiography and fashion on the way history is experienced, shared and passed on to next generation.
